Output 10800887c25fd9b7c56eb08538a26a77574360b112bceba7e37550415f832659:1

value
31082339
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d01443c055df247aeaeeda31349712fd179a1fb2 OP_EQUAL
address
3LfEkTUbFwvRQsz6BZQuzfDs7Do9RSMuhX
transaction
10800887c25fd9b7c56eb08538a26a77574360b112bceba7e37550415f832659
spent
true